At its heart, the plinko game relies on the principles of physics, specifically gravity and probability. A ball is dropped from the top of a board filled with strategically placed pegs. As the ball falls, it randomly deflects left or right with each peg it encounters. This random deflection determines the final landing spot, typically a series of slots at the bottom of the board, each offering a distinct payout value. The design of the peg arrangement greatly influences the statistical probability of the ball landing in each slot. A denser arrangement of pegs tends to create a more random outcome, while a more spaced-out arrangement might favor certain slots.
The odds in a plinko game aren’t always straightforward. They are often influenced by the board’s design and the payout structure. Understanding these factors can offer players insights into optimal strategies, even though the game is fundamentally based on chance. While the plinko game is largely a game of chance, some players attempt to employ strategies based on observing patterns or analyzing the board’s layout. However, it’s crucial to understand that the core mechanics are inherently random. These ‘strategies’ often fall into the realm of player psychology rather than providing a tangible edge. Some advocate for analyzing previous results to identify potential biases in the board, but results are unlikely to affect future drops. Others may believe certain drop points yield better results, but again, this is subject to the random nature of the game.
Effective bankroll management is a more realistic and sensible approach to playing plinko. Setting limits on your spending and understanding the inherent risks are essential for responsible gameplay. Treat the game as a form of entertainment, rather than a guaranteed income source. Managing expectations and playing within affordable bounds enhance enjoyment and minimize the likelihood of losses.
The foundational plinko concept has evolved into numerous variations, particularly within the digital sphere. Online versions of the game often introduce new features, such as adjustable payout multipliers, bonus rounds, and even progressive jackpots. These modifications add layers of complexity and excitement, catering to a wider range of player preferences. Many online casinos and game platforms offer variations with different themes and visual designs, all maintaining the core plinko gameplay. Some incorporate unique elements, like cascading symbols or multiplier increments with each bounce.
Beyond simple adaptations, some developers have integrated plinko mechanics into larger game formats. For instance, some slot games incorporate a plinko-style bonus round, offering players a chance to win additional prizes based on the ball’s descent. This cross-pollination of game formats demonstrates the enduring appeal and versatility of the plinko concept within the broader gaming ecosystem.
